After eating a healthy meal with your family, you are helping to clean up the leftovers. In order to prevent foodborne illnesses, you want to properly store the leftovers.
Which food safety storage procedures should you follow? Select two options.
Place leftovers that you intend to eat seven days from now into the refrigerator.
Discard any food left out at room temperature for more than two hours.
Place food into containers and immediately put them in the refrigerator or freezer.
Put leftover food on plates directly into the refrigerator.
Throw the leftover food in the trash right away, as it is no longer safe to eat.

Answers

Answer:

Discard any food left out at room temperature for more than two hours.

Place food into containers and immediately put them in the refrigerator or freezer.

Explanation:

The FDA recommends the 2-hour rule to prevent people from getting bacteria that grow on the food within that time period (if longer). This can lead to illnesses.

Once you're done eating, it is safe for you to put the food into containers so that bacteria cannot be grown on them. But you should be wary, the containers might be a bit of a problem if the food is too hot or if it's not cleaned well.

"Place leftovers that you intend to eat seven days from now into the refrigerator." This is an unhealthy decision because it can lead to bacteria growing on the food within that time, this also goes with "Put leftover food on plates directly into the refrigerator."

"Throw the leftover food in the trash right away, as it is no longer safe to eat." This is not always the case because sometimes the food might've been out for only just half an hour (or any time less than 2 hours).

state three reasons for preserving food

Answers

Answer:

three reasons for preserving food:

1) to prevent the growth of microorganisms, such as yeasts, and the spread of pathogenic bacteria (which causes spoilage)

2) to reduce/delay the oxidation of fats which result in rancidity

3) to reduce waste and unnecessary expenses
